Skip to content

Commit 7905e3e

Browse files
authored
fix: Fix old docs links redirects (#5646)
1 parent 65009b6 commit 7905e3e

1 file changed

Lines changed: 63 additions & 63 deletions

File tree

redirects.yaml

Lines changed: 63 additions & 63 deletions
Original file line numberDiff line numberDiff line change
@@ -146,74 +146,74 @@ docs/gnome-3-34-extension/?: https://forum.snapcraft.io/t/the-gnome-3-34-extensi
146146
docs/snapcraft-interfaces/?: https://forum.snapcraft.io/t/supported-interfaces/7744
147147

148148
# Old URL redirects
149-
docs/build-snaps: /docs/snap-format
150-
docs/build-snaps/build-for-another-arch: /docs/building-snaps
151-
docs/build-snaps/build-on-lxd-docker: /docs/build-snaps-on-docker
152-
docs/build-snaps/builders: /docs/t/building-the-snap/6800
153-
docs/build-snaps/debugging: /docs/debugging-building-snaps
154-
docs/build-snaps/electron: /docs/electron-apps
155-
docs/build-snaps/go: /docs/go-applications
156-
docs/build-snaps/hooks: /docs/supported-snap-hooks
157-
docs/build-snaps/java: /docs/java-applications
158-
docs/build-snaps/languages: /docs/creating-a-snap
159-
docs/build-snaps/metadata: /docs/snapcraft-app-and-service-metadata
160-
docs/build-snaps/moos: /docs/moos-applications
161-
docs/build-snaps/node: /docs/node-apps
162-
docs/build-snaps/parts: /docs/remote-reusable-parts
163-
docs/build-snaps/plugins: /docs/snapcraft-plugin-api
164-
docs/build-snaps/pre-built: /docs/t/pre-built-apps/6739
165-
docs/build-snaps/publish: /docs/releasing-to-the-snap-store
166-
docs/build-snaps/register-snap: /docs/registering-your-app-name
167-
docs/build-snaps/release: /docs/releasing-your-app
168-
docs/build-snaps/remote-parts: /docs/remote-reusable-parts
169-
docs/build-snaps/ros: /docs/ros-applications
170-
docs/build-snaps/ros2: /docs/ros2-applications
171-
docs/build-snaps/ruby: /docs/ruby-applications
172-
docs/build-snaps/rust: /docs/rust-applications
173-
docs/build-snaps/syntax: /docs/snapcraft-yaml-reference
174-
docs/build-snaps/upload: /docs/releasing-your-app
175-
docs/build-snaps/your-first-snap: /docs/build-on-lxd
176-
docs/core: /docs/quickstart-tour
177-
docs/core/install-arch-linux: /docs/installing-snap-on-arch-linux
178-
docs/core/install-debian: /docs/installing-snap-on-debian
179-
docs/core/install-elementary-os: /docs/installing-snap-on-elementary-os
180-
docs/core/install-fedora: /docs/installing-snap-on-fedora
181-
docs/core/install-gentoo: /docs/installing-snapd
182-
docs/core/install-linux-mint: /docs/installing-snap-on-linux-mint
183-
docs/core/install-manjaro: /docs/installing-snap-on-manjaro-linux
184-
docs/core/install-oe-yocto: /docs/installing-snapd
185-
docs/core/install-opensuse: /docs/installing-snapd
186-
docs/core/install-openwrt: /docs/installing-snapd
187-
docs/core/install-raspbian: /docs/installing-snap-on-raspbian
188-
docs/core/install-solus: /docs/installing-snap-on-solus
189-
docs/core/install-ubuntu: /docs/installing-snap-on-ubuntu
190-
docs/core/install: /docs/installing-snapd
191-
docs/core/interfaces: /docs/interface-management
192-
docs/core/updates: /docs/keeping-snaps-up-to-date
193-
docs/core/usage: /docs/quickstart-tour
194-
docs/deprecation-notices/dn1: /docs/t/deprecation-notice-1/8397
195-
docs/deprecation-notices/dn2: /docs/t/deprecation-notice-2/8398
196-
docs/deprecation-notices/dn3: /docs/t/deprecation-notice-3/8403
197-
docs/deprecation-notices/dn4: /docs/t/deprecation-notice-4/8404
198-
docs/deprecation-notices/dn5: /docs/t/deprecation-notice-5/8405
199-
docs/deprecation-notices/dn6: /docs/t/deprecation-notice-6/8406
200-
docs/deprecation-notices/dn7: /docs/t/deprecation-notice-7/8407
201-
docs/deprecation-notices/dn8: /docs/t/deprecation-notice-8/8408
202-
docs/deprecation-notices/dn9: /docs/t/deprecation-notice-9/8409
203-
docs/reference/channels: /docs/channels
204-
docs/reference/confinement: /docs/snap-confinement
205-
docs/reference/env: /docs/environment-variables
206-
docs/reference/interfaces: /docs/interface-management
149+
docs/build-snaps/?: /docs/snap-format
150+
docs/build-snaps/build-for-another-arch/?: /docs/building-snaps
151+
docs/build-snaps/build-on-lxd-docker/?: /docs/build-snaps-on-docker
152+
docs/build-snaps/builders/?: /docs/t/building-the-snap/6800
153+
docs/build-snaps/debugging/?: /docs/debugging-building-snaps
154+
docs/build-snaps/electron/?: /docs/electron-apps
155+
docs/build-snaps/go/?: /docs/go-applications
156+
docs/build-snaps/hooks/?: /docs/supported-snap-hooks
157+
docs/build-snaps/java/?: /docs/java-applications
158+
docs/build-snaps/languages/?: /docs/creating-a-snap
159+
docs/build-snaps/metadata/?: /docs/snapcraft-app-and-service-metadata
160+
docs/build-snaps/moos/?: /docs/moos-applications
161+
docs/build-snaps/node/?: /docs/node-apps
162+
docs/build-snaps/parts/?: /docs/remote-reusable-parts
163+
docs/build-snaps/plugins/?: /docs/snapcraft-plugin-api
164+
docs/build-snaps/pre-built/?: /docs/t/pre-built-apps/6739
165+
docs/build-snaps/publish/?: /docs/releasing-to-the-snap-store
166+
docs/build-snaps/register-snap/?: /docs/registering-your-app-name
167+
docs/build-snaps/release/?: /docs/releasing-your-app
168+
docs/build-snaps/remote-parts/?: /docs/remote-reusable-parts
169+
docs/build-snaps/ros/?: /docs/ros-applications
170+
docs/build-snaps/ros2/?: /docs/ros2-applications
171+
docs/build-snaps/ruby/?: /docs/ruby-applications
172+
docs/build-snaps/rust/?: /docs/rust-applications
173+
docs/build-snaps/syntax/?: /docs/snapcraft-yaml-reference
174+
docs/build-snaps/upload/?: /docs/releasing-your-app
175+
docs/build-snaps/your-first-snap/?: /docs/build-on-lxd
176+
docs/core/?: /docs/quickstart-tour
177+
docs/core/install-arch-linux/?: /docs/installing-snap-on-arch-linux
178+
docs/core/install-debian/?: /docs/installing-snap-on-debian
179+
docs/core/install-elementary-os/?: /docs/installing-snap-on-elementary-os
180+
docs/core/install-fedora/?: /docs/installing-snap-on-fedora
181+
docs/core/install-gentoo/?: /docs/installing-snapd
182+
docs/core/install-linux-mint/?: /docs/installing-snap-on-linux-mint
183+
docs/core/install-manjaro/?: /docs/installing-snap-on-manjaro-linux
184+
docs/core/install-oe-yocto/?: /docs/installing-snapd
185+
docs/core/install-opensuse/?: /docs/installing-snapd
186+
docs/core/install-openwrt/?: /docs/installing-snapd
187+
docs/core/install-raspbian/?: /docs/installing-snap-on-raspbian
188+
docs/core/install-solus/?: /docs/installing-snap-on-solus
189+
docs/core/install-ubuntu/?: /docs/installing-snap-on-ubuntu
190+
docs/core/install/?: /docs/installing-snapd
191+
docs/core/interfaces/?: /docs/interface-management
192+
docs/core/updates/?: /docs/keeping-snaps-up-to-date
193+
docs/core/usage/?: /docs/quickstart-tour
194+
docs/deprecation-notices/dn1/?: /docs/t/deprecation-notice-1/8397
195+
docs/deprecation-notices/dn2/?: /docs/t/deprecation-notice-2/8398
196+
docs/deprecation-notices/dn3/?: /docs/t/deprecation-notice-3/8403
197+
docs/deprecation-notices/dn4/?: /docs/t/deprecation-notice-4/8404
198+
docs/deprecation-notices/dn5/?: /docs/t/deprecation-notice-5/8405
199+
docs/deprecation-notices/dn6/?: /docs/t/deprecation-notice-6/8406
200+
docs/deprecation-notices/dn7/?: /docs/t/deprecation-notice-7/8407
201+
docs/deprecation-notices/dn8/?: /docs/t/deprecation-notice-8/8408
202+
docs/deprecation-notices/dn9/?: /docs/t/deprecation-notice-9/8409
203+
docs/reference/channels/?: /docs/channels
204+
docs/reference/confinement/?: /docs/snap-confinement
205+
docs/reference/env/?: /docs/environment-variables
206+
docs/reference/interfaces/?: /docs/interface-management
207207
docs/reference/plugins.*: /docs/writing-local-plugins
208-
docs/snaps: /docs
209-
docs/snaps/intro: /docs/quickstart-tour
210-
docs/snaps/metadata: /docs/snap-format
211-
docs/snaps/structure: /docs/system-snap-directory
208+
docs/snaps/?: /docs
209+
docs/snaps/intro/?: /docs/quickstart-tour
210+
docs/snaps/metadata/?: /docs/snap-format
211+
docs/snaps/structure/?: /docs/system-snap-directory
212212
account/details: /admin/account
213213

214214
# Redirects webhook requests using old URL format (i.e. not starting with api/)
215215
(?P<snap_name>[^/]*)/webhook/notify: /api/{snap_name}/webhook/notify
216-
(?!api/.*)(?P<github_owner>[^/]*)/(?P<github_repo>[^/]*)/webhook/notify: /api/{github_owner}/{github_repo}/webhook/notify
216+
(?!api/.*)(?P<github_owner>[^/]*)/(?P<github_repo>[^/]*)/webhook/notify: /api/{github_owner}/{github_repo}/webhook/notify
217217

218218
# First snap flow pages
219219
first-snap/python: https://documentation.ubuntu.com/snapcraft/stable/how-to/integrations/craft-a-python-app/

0 commit comments

Comments
 (0)